2678777127 发表于 2018-2-11 11:49:25


            上一篇文章已经介绍了如何整合阿里云oss,这一篇主要介绍上传文件到阿里云oss。
主要思路:首先文件要上传到服务器,然后把服务器里边的文件传到阿里云oss,成功以后就把文件信息写入数据库,失败了就删除服务器的文件。
主要步骤:
0 介绍几个oss的概念。
accessKeyId   ==>> 可以理解为访问阿里云oss的账号
accessKeySecret ==>> 可以理解为访问阿里云oss的密码
bucket          ==>> 可以理解为文件在保存的根目录
endPoint      ==>> 把它放在空间和ossfile中间,就组成了访问文件的url路径,也是获取阿里云图片的方式。
object          ==>> 你的文件传到了阿里云oss以后,路径是什么,叫什么名字
看截图更容易理解一些:
http://files.jb51.net/file_images/article/201709/2017919100618168.jpg?201781910644
1 文件上传还是涉及mvc,这次从view开始,主要就是展示一个表单,用来提交文件。aliyunoss.php代码如下:
['enctype' => 'multipart/form-data']]) ?>
field($model, 'files')->fileInput() ?>
Submit
页: [1]
查看完整版本: yii2.0整合阿里云oss上传单个文件的示例